Write the equation of the line that passes through (–1, 4) with a slope of –1 in standard form

jimthompson5910 (jim_thompson5910):

y = mx+b y = -1x+ b ... plug in m = -1 y = -x + b 4 = -1*(-1)+b ... plug in x = -1 and y = 4 Now solve for b
